Burlington Cars  – Canon Canonet QL17 35mm film

Burlington Cars – Canon Canonet QL17 35mm film

Yet another classic car show in Burlington. This time it was on Brant St near the Lakeshore. Another great excuse to grab the Canon Canonet 35mm Rangefinder camera. I had FujiColor Pro 160S 35mm film in the camera this time.

Cars around Burlington – Pentax 6×7 Kodak 160VC

Cars around Burlington – Pentax 6×7 Kodak 160VC

Getting used to the Asahi Pentax 6×7, this time using Kodak Portra 160VC 120 film. I have to say I didn’t like the results of this medium format 120 size film. The VC actually stands for “Vivid Colors”.
